A note on Log4j Flaw

Robustness and security are at the core of the interTouch value proposition, and we rigorously monitor potential threats that can affect our services and the data privacy of our end customers, our partners, as well as our team.

Since 09 December, a new cyber-attack known as CVE-2021-44228 (Log4j or Log4Shell) has been spreading worldwide. Essentially, attackers are attempting to exploit a critical security vulnerability in the Java logging library Apache Log4j to install malware, steal user credentials and more.

Please note that none of our interTouch products and services you are using rely on the affected Log4j library and are therefore not affected by this threat. 

To confirm this our Operations, Security and Development Teams proactively checked our platforms with our vulnerability scanner and revealed that no external or internal services rely on the affected library.
